Custom Wiring Harness Design

Custom wiring harness design ensures that electrical systems are tailored to the exact requirements of the application. American Cordset Industries works from customer-provided specifications or engineering documentation to manufacture wiring harnesses that integrate seamlessly into equipment and systems.


Harness designs are configured to accommodate conductor count, wire gauge, connector types, and routing constraints. Proper layout and bundling reduce electrical interference, improve serviceability, and enhance overall system performance. Design considerations also include flexibility, bend radius, and strain relief placement to prevent conductor fatigue and premature failure.

Assembly Inspection and Electrical Testing

Assembly inspection and testing play a vital role in verifying wiring harness quality and functionality. American Cordset Industries incorporates inspection and testing procedures throughout the manufacturing process to confirm that each harness meets specified requirements.



Electrical testing is performed to verify continuity, correct pinout, and proper termination. These tests help identify potential issues before installation, reducing the risk of system failure and downtime. Visual inspections are conducted to confirm proper routing, bundling, and component placement.
